Bangladesh Air Force’s New Turkish ALP-300G Radar Extends Air Surveillance Across the Region

Reading Time: 3 minutes Key Highlights Bangladesh Air Force (BAF) to deploy the Turkish-made ALP-300G long-range early warning radar. Operational range: 450 km; Maximum detection range: 800 km. Enables BAF to monitor aerial activity across seven countries — Bangladesh, India, Myanmar, Bhutan, Nepal, China (Tibet), and parts of Thailand. Radar features advanced AESA, digital beamforming, ECCM, and IFF Mode 5/S capabilities. Significantly enhances Bangladesh’s situational awareness, air defence readiness, and strategic deterrence. A New Era in Air Surveillance The Bangladesh Air Force (BAF) is set to transform its regional surveillance capability with the induction of Türkiye’s ALP-300G long-range early warning radar, a state-of-the-art S-band system developed under the “Uzun Menzilli Erken İhbar Radar Sistemi (EİRS)” project. Deliveries of the radar began in May 2024, and the system represents a major leap forward in radar technology for Bangladesh’s integrated air defence network.
